Zaporozhye region is connected to the unified gas transmission system of Russia – authorities

Zaporozhye region is connected to the unified gas transmission system of the Russian Federation. Berdyansk became the first city where gas began to be supplied.

This was announced by the chairman of the movement “We are together with Russia”, a member of the main council of the administration of the Zaporozhye region Vladimir Rogov.

“Zaporozhye region was connected to the unified gas transmission system of the Russian Federation. Gas is supplied to boiler houses and enterprises of the city. Centralized gas supply has already been restored in 35 multi-apartment and 165 private residential buildings. 3,000 residents of the city are already in the heat. Work to restore gas supply has just begun”, Rogov said (quoted by RIA Novosti).

According to the politician, after the launch of the new gas pipeline, gas from Berdyansk will be supplied to Melitopol and other settlements of the region.

Recall that in July of this year, by order of the Kyiv regime, gas supply was turned off in the region. In order to ensure the energy security of the region, it was decided to lay the Berdyansk-Melitopol gas pipeline in order to supply the part of the region that remained without gas.
